Rhodium(III)-Catalyzed Three-Component Cascade Annulation for Modular Assembly of N-Alkoxylated Isoindolin-1-Ones with Quaternary Carbon Center

A cascade C−H activation, annulation, and etherification of N-hydroxybenzamides with propargylamines provides a flexible route to N-alkoxylated 3-arylisoindolin-1-ones. Three new bonds (C−C, C−N, and C−O) are generated to afford a series of isoindolin-1-ones bearing a tetrasubstituted carbon in 49–82% yield. The utility of this method was showcased by gram-scale synthesis and synthetic transformations of the product to access structurally diverse isoindolinones.

铑 (III) 催化的三组分级联环化用于具有季碳中心的 N-烷氧基化 Isoindolin-1-Ones 的模块化组装

N-羟基苯甲酰胺与炔丙基胺的级联 C-H 活化、环化和醚化为N-烷氧基化 3-arylisoindolin-1-ones提供了灵活的途径。生成三个新键(C-C、C-N 和 C-O),以 49-82% 的产率提供一系列带有四取代碳的异吲哚啉-1-酮。该方法的实用性通过产品的克级合成和合成转化来获得结构多样的异吲哚啉酮得到展示。
